Do I need to play FF15 before FF16?

To answer the question directly, no, you don’t need to play Final Fantasy 15 (FF15) before Final Fantasy 16 (FF16), as each mainline Final Fantasy game tells its own standalone story with unique settings and characters. The storyline of FF16 is completely separate from FF15, allowing new players to jump straight into the world of Clive Rosfield without any prior knowledge of the franchise.

Understanding Final Fantasy 16

Final Fantasy 16 is the latest addition to the series, offering a mature story, action-packed combat, and stunning visuals. The game is set in a completely new world, with its own unique characters, storyline, and gameplay mechanics. This makes it an ideal starting point for new players, who can enjoy the game without feeling overwhelmed by the need to understand previous Final Fantasy games.
